Getting around Pisco is quite straightforward. Taxis are readily available and affordable for trips within the city and to nearby attractions like the airport or bus terminals. For exploring the immediate city center, walking is a pleasant option. Many visitors opt for organized tours that often include transportation to key sites like the Ballestas Islands and Paracas National Reserve, providing a convenient way to see the region. If venturing further afield independently, local colectivos (shared vans) offer a budget-friendly, albeit less comfortable, way to travel along the Pan-American Highway.

Pisco enjoys a desert climate, characterized by sunshine year-round and very little rainfall. Coastal fog, known as 'garúa,' is common during the winter months, often obscuring the sun but keeping temperatures mild. Summers are warm and dry, with clear skies ideal for exploring the coast.
The best months to visit Pisco are generally from March to November, avoiding the peak summer heat and the denser winter fog. This period offers pleasant temperatures and clearer skies for enjoying both the city and its natural surroundings.
The peak season in Pisco typically falls during the summer months of December to February, coinciding with school holidays. Expect warmer weather, more crowds, and potentially higher prices for accommodation and tours.
The off-season runs from May to October, marked by cooler temperatures and the presence of coastal fog, especially in the mornings. While not ideal for sunbathing, this period offers fewer tourists and more competitive prices, making it attractive for budget-conscious travelers.
